Maintaining and Replacing Wheel Studs and Nuts on Your 2016 Honda Odyssey

The 2016 Honda Odyssey, like most vehicles, relies on a crucial component known as wheel studs and nuts to secure the wheels to the vehicle's hub. Ensuring these components are in good working order is an essential part of vehicle maintenance. A malfunction or failure in these parts can lead to serious safety issues, so it's important to keep them in check.

Wheel studs are the small but mighty components that protrude from the wheel hub. They work in conjunction with wheel nuts, securing your vehicle's wheels firmly in place. Over time, these parts can face wear and tear, potentially leading to damage or malfunctioning if not properly maintained. Factors such as regular driving, exposure to elements, or incorrect installation can affect their durability and performance, necessitating regular inspection.

  1. Regular Inspection

Regularly inspecting the wheel studs and nuts is a relatively straightforward process. Ensure that the wheel nuts are tightened to the recommended torque specification. For the Odyssey, it typically falls between 108 to 113 Nm. This can prevent the wheel from becoming too loose - leading to a dangerous situation - or too tight - leading to damage such as stripped threads. You can achieve this with a torque wrench, ensuring precision and appropriate tightness. During your inspection, look out for signs of rust or wear, such as stripped threads or rounded edges on the nuts.

  1. Replacement Process

If you notice any wear or damage, it is advisable to replace the faulty parts promptly. Replacing wheel studs and nuts isn't overly complicated, but it requires attention to detail and proper tools. Here's a general process for replacing these components:

  • Begin by safely lifting the vehicle and removing the wheel. Prepare to take out the damaged stud or nut.
  • For studs, you might need to tap them out with a hammer or press them out using a specialized tool. Wheel nuts can simply be unscrewed and replaced if they're damaged.
  • Install the new wheel stud by aligning it with the hole on the hub and pulling it through using a wheel nut. This can be accomplished by placing washers over the stud and tightening the wheel nut against them. When properly tightened, the stud will pull through the hub.
  • Install the new wheel nuts, ensuring they match the specifications for your Odyssey. It's best to avoid aftermarket alternatives that may not offer the reliability of original equipment manufacturer parts.
  • Finally, replace the wheel and tighten the nuts to the correct torque specification.
  1. Maintenance Best Practices

Preventive maintenance can help extend the life of your wheel studs and nuts. Regularly checking the torque and ensuring they're free from moisture and debris can assist in maintaining their integrity. Avoid using lubrication on the bolts where possible, as it can cause over-tightening. If dealing with corrosion or rust, applying a resistant coating might be beneficial in protecting the metal parts from further environmental damage.

  1. Safety Considerations

While working with the wheels or any part of the vehicle, safety should be a priority. Always ensure the vehicle is properly supported on jack stands. Use protective gear, such as gloves and safety glasses, to avoid injury from tools or parts. If there's any uncertainty about replacing wheel studs or nuts, consulting a professional mechanic can be the safest alternative.
